Labrador Retrievers: Do Labrador retrievers get fat

The Labrador retriever, known as one of the

greediest breeds

of dog, is hard-wired to overeat, research suggests. The dog is more likely to become obese than other breeds partly because of its genes , scientists at Cambridge University say.

Why are Labradors so hungry?


Labradors:

Why are Labradors always hungry? A 2016 study at the University of Cambridge found that Labradors’ insatiable appetite might be due to changes in a specific gene, called the POMC gene When the POMC gene is changed, the chemical messages which tell a Lab when he’s full don’t work properly.

Labradors Smell: Why do Labradors smell

Bred to work in and around water, Labradors have a dense double coat with an oily outer layer which offers almost perfect waterproofing. These oils in your dog’s fur are part of the source of his distinctive doggy smell And they can smell particularly strong when your dog is damp and drying off after a swim.

Is a Labrador a gun dog?


Labrador:

The Labrador Retriever is the world’s top gundog today , having risen from relative obscurity following its initial arrival in Britain. In the early 1800s, a select group of aristocrats bought these dogs from fishermen returning from Newfoundland and developed the breed as a shooting companion on their own estates.

Potatoes Good: Are potatoes good for dogs

You should never feed your dog a raw potato White potatoes belong to the nightshade family of vegetables, which includes tomatoes. Like tomatoes, raw potatoes contain solanine, a compound that is toxic to some dogs. However, cooking a potato reduces the levels of solanine.
